In 2013, I learned about the concept of an ASIC (Application-Specific Integrated Circuit), a machine made on goal for bitcoin mining. You connect this machine to your own computer and use it insead of your own card.

In mid-2013, the smallest ASIC being produced by Butterfly Labs could produce 5Gh/s, that is, it worked 500 times faster than my graphics card. Butterfly was also developing 50 Gh/s ASICs, large boys, called Singles. One other company, Avalon, made ASICs, however they were only selling them in batches, and there was a long waiting list; you could not get one instantly. .

Butterfly Labs stated their ASICs would draw 5W per Gh/s that they hash. For comparison, a 42" LCD TV is graded to utilize about 200W. So the 5Gh/s Jalapeno miner would utilize 0.6 kilowatt-hours every day, although the 50GH/s"big boy" would use 3 kWh; should you paid 15 cents to get a kilowatt-hour, operating the"big boy" ASIC miner would include about $10 to your monthly electricity bill. .

At the moment, in mid-2013, a BTC mining profitability calculator estimated that you would earn $17 a day together with the 5Gh/s Jalapeno ASIC, and $170 with all the 50Gh/s ASIC, after factoring in the cost of the energy you'd use.

These machines were not economical; the 50GH/s one sold for $2,500. However, according to the bitcoin mining profitability calculator at the time, the huge boy could"pay for itself" in 15 days. And then you would be printing money. All you would have to do to earn money would be to sign into an exchange once in a while, to sell the coins which youve mined. .

In summer 2013, I purchased a 5 Gh/s Jalapeno, which then produced roughly $15 a day. But the calculated profit was shrinking fast at that moment. As of Nov. 2013 the estimate was already down to $3 to get a Jalapeo and $30 for the 50Gh/s ASIC.

From Jan 2014, the Jalapeno was hardly worth running; it only made a bit more than a dollar per day. By that time, the large boy, the Find Out More 50Gh/s ButterflyLabs machine, when I had bought one, would have made just over $10 a dayless than my Jalapeno had been making the previous summer.

Unlike ordinary fiat currencies (like US dollars or euros), bitcoin assets are not controlled by a central government or bank, and new bitcoin (BTC) cannot be printed and issued like paper money. Instead, bitcoin tokens are introduced into the market via a process known as mining. BTC are given to the miners who have solved the mathematics problems necessary to confirm bitcoin transactions. .

Whenever a transaction is created in bitcoin, a record of it's made on a block containing other recent transactions, like a webpage in a ledger. Once the cube is complete, bitcoin miners compete against one another to verify and confirm the block and all its transactions by solving a complex cryptographic issue. .

The first miner to accomplish that is given a set amount of bitcoin, dependent on her response the mining issue at the moment. The verified block is then inserted into the blockchain, a history of all blocks verified since the beginning of bitcoin, and transmitted to users of bitcoin so they can possess the latest blockchain. .

At the center of bitcoin mining lies a difficult, mathematical problem. The target is to ensure that the process of adding a new block into the blockchain requires a great deal of work. That helps to ensure that any hacker tampering with the transactions needs not only to mess with all the transactions but also win the race of bitcoin mining. .
